Key Responsibilities
Campaign Execution and Trafficking
- Traffic and manage all direct-sold digital advertising campaigns across Firecrown brand sites, newsletters, and video properties
- Own the full campaign lifecycle from IO receipt through delivery, optimization, and post-campaign reporting
- Manage ad tags, creative assets, and QA across desktop, mobile, and email environments
- Ensure campaigns are pacing correctly and proactively flag delivery issues to account managers and sales
Platform and Technology Management
- Serve as the primary administrator for Firecrown's ad serving platform (Google Ad Manager) and related tools including AdOrbit
- Manage programmatic demand relationships including PMPs, programmatic direct deals, and open exchange partners
- Troubleshoot ad rendering issues across site environments and coordinate with development and editorial teams on technical resolutions
- Evaluate and implement new ad tech vendors, formats, and capabilities as the portfolio grows
Yield Optimization and Revenue Operations
- Monitor and optimize inventory yield across direct-sold and programmatic channels
- Build and maintain reporting dashboards and weekly delivery reports for internal stakeholders and clients
- Identify underperforming inventory and work with leadership to develop packaging, pricing, or product improvements
Cross-Functional Collaboration
- Partner with the client delivery, marketing, and sales teams to provide pre-sale availability checks, spec guidance, and custom execution support for larger client programs
- Work with editorial and design on sponsored content placements, native ad integrations, and branded content deliverables
- Support the Client Success team on reporting, makegoods, and campaign renewals
- Serve as the internal expert on ad product capabilities, helping sales position and spec new digital offerings
